Memo To :Mary Saarion, Director of Parks and Recreation <br />From :Ric Minetor, City Engineer/Director of Public Works <br />Date :September 21, 1989 <br />L <br />Subject :Greenfield Park Baseball Field Expansion <br />I have developed a rough estimate of the cost of extending the <br />right field line to 300 feet. The main cost is the piping and <br />filling of the ditch adjacent to right field. I assumed a total <br />of 200 feet of ditch will need to be piped. The cost of the pie, <br />fill, and turf establishment is approximately $25,000. The major <br />cost is the fill required which accounts for $17,000 of the <br />total. This is a rough estimate and should not be relied upon for <br />project cost, the intent is only as a preliminary study cost to <br />determine if this option should be studied in detail. The actual <br />costs could be as much as twice the estimate or possibly as <br />little as half the estimate; the range could be considered to be <br />$12,500 to $40,000. <br />
